If you would like to join Wizz Air Flight Crew team as a non-type rated First Officer into the position of an Airbus A320/321 First Officer, please see below the requirements for applying.

Wizz Air Cadet Non-Type Rated First Officer Job

Requirements (taken from the Wizz air recruitment site)

  • Unrestricted right to live and work in the EU or Albania, Bosnia and Herzegovina, Georgia, Moldova, North Macedonia, Russia, Serbia, Ukraine, United Arab Emirates, United Kingdom
  • Valid EASA / UK Commercial Pilot License (CPL) 
  • Valid Class 1 Medical Certificate 
  • Valid Instrument Rating (IR) for Multi-Engine aeroplane (ME) 
  • Last flight within the preceding 6 months (preferable, not hard limit due to COVID-19 effects) 
  • ATPL theory completed* (certificate or license endorsement as remark) 
  • MCC course completed** (certificate or license endorsement as remark) 
  • UPRT training completed*** (certificate and 3 hours TTL logbook entry on certified aircraft) 
  • ICAO level 4/5/6 English proficiency

    AND

    Total 145 hours actual flight time on fixed wing aircraft**** with integrated ATPL theory completed

    OR

    Total 200 hours actual flight time on fixed wing aircraft**** with CPL/IR training completed in modular system 

Notes:

*ATPL theory certificate issued by any EASA / UK CAA or entered into the license 

**MCC is not required if multi-crew aircraft flown before or complex type rating (e.g. B737) completed

***Advanced UPRT is not required if any type rating on complex aircraft completed before

**** Ultra-light aircraft, power gliders, simulator and helicopter hours are excluded 

During the application process, you will need to have your:

  • Resume/CV prepared in DOCX, PDF, Image or Text format
  • Cover/motivational letter prepared in DOCX, PDF, Image or Text format if you wish to upload (optional)
  • Passport scanned
  • Flight Crew License scanned
  • Class1 Medical License scanned
  • ATPL Certifcate scanned (if applicable)
  • MCC Certificate scanned (if applicable)
  • JOC Certificate scanned (if applicable)
  • UPRT Certificate scanned (if applicalbe)
  • Pilot Logbook prepared, so you are able to enter your previous experience
